Revolutionizing Field Services: Unleashing the Power of Deepfake Generators and AI for Learning & Training Videos In today's fast-paced world, businesses are constantly seeking innovative ways to enhance their training and development programs. The advent of artificial intelligence (AI) has opened up new possibilities, particularly in the field of learning and training videos. One of the most exciting advancements in this area is the use of deepfake generators and AI technology, which have the potential to revolutionize field services. Deepfake technology utilizes AI algorithms to generate realistic, but entirely synthetic, video content. While initially known for its controversial use in creating fake news and spreading misinformation, deepfake generators have found a positive application in the realm of learning and training videos. By leveraging this technology, businesses can create highly engaging and interactive training content, which can enhance the learning experience for employees in the field services sector. So, how exactly can deepfake generators and AI be harnessed to create effective learning and training videos for field services? 1. Realistic Scenarios: One of the key challenges of traditional training videos is their limited ability to replicate real-world scenarios. With deepfake technology, businesses can create highly realistic scenarios that closely resemble actual field service situations. This allows trainees to experience and learn from a wide range of scenarios in a safe and controlled environment. For example, imagine a deepfake-generated video that simulates a challenging customer interaction in a retail setting. Trainees can observe and analyze the behavior of both the customer and the service representative, enabling them to develop effective strategies for handling similar situations in the future. 2. Personalized Learning: AI-powered deepfake technology can also be used to customize learning experiences based on the individual needs of trainees. By analyzing trainee performance and preferences, AI algorithms can generate personalized training videos that address specific areas of improvement. This tailored approach ensures that trainees receive the most relevant and impactful training, leading to faster skill development and improved performance in the field. 3. Interactive Training: Traditional training videos often lack interactivity, making them less engaging for trainees. Deepfake generators, combined with AI, can introduce interactive elements into training videos. Trainees can actively participate in the video by making decisions or solving problems, leading to a more immersive and engaging learning experience. This interactive nature of deepfake-generated videos not only enhances trainee engagement but also improves knowledge retention and application. 4. Multilingual Support: In global organizations, language barriers can pose a significant challenge when it comes to training and development. Deepfake generators can help overcome this obstacle by creating training videos in multiple languages. AI algorithms can seamlessly generate translated audio and subtitles, ensuring that training content is accessible to a diverse workforce. This democratization of training resources enables businesses to provide consistent and effective learning experiences across different regions. While the potential of deepfake generators and AI for learning and training videos in field services is immense, it is important to acknowledge the ethical considerations associated with this technology. As with any AI-powered solution, transparency and responsible usage must be upheld to prevent misuse or unintended consequences. In conclusion, the integration of deepfake generators and AI technology into learning and training videos has the power to revolutionize field services. By providing realistic scenarios, personalized learning experiences, interactivity, and multilingual support, businesses can enhance the effectiveness and impact of their training programs. As this technology continues to evolve, organizations must embrace it responsibly to unlock its full potential and equip their field service teams with the skills they need to thrive in an ever-changing world.
